The Origins and Evolution of Biathlon

Biathlon’s roots can be traced back to prehistoric times when hunting on skis was a survival skill in snow-covered regions. However, the modern sport finds its more direct ancestry in military training. Scandinavian countries, particularly Norway, were pioneers in developing ski-based military units. These soldiers needed to be proficient in both cross-country skiing and marksmanship, skills that would prove crucial in winter warfare.

The first recorded biathlon-like competition took place in 1767 between Swedish and Norwegian border patrol companies. These early contests helped refine the skills necessary for winter combat and laid the groundwork for the sport we know today. Throughout the 19th and early 20th centuries, similar military competitions spread across Europe and North America, gradually evolving into more standardized events.

The sport made its Olympic debut as a demonstration event at the 1924 Winter Games in Chamonix, France. However, it wasn’t until 1960 in Squaw Valley, USA, that biathlon became an official Olympic sport for men. Women’s biathlon was later introduced at the 1992 Albertville Games, marking a significant step towards gender equality in the sport.

Over the years, biathlon has undergone numerous changes to enhance its appeal and fairness. The transition from high-powered military rifles to .22 caliber small-bore rifles in the 1978-79 season made the sport safer and more accessible. The introduction of electronic targets in the 1980s revolutionized the accuracy of scoring and the spectator experience. More recently, the pursuit and mass start events have been added to the program, increasing the excitement and tactical elements of the competition.

The Technical Challenges of Biathlon

At its core, biathlon is a sport of contrasts. The cross-country skiing portion demands explosive power, endurance, and efficient technique. Athletes must navigate challenging terrain at high speeds, often covering distances of 10 to 20 kilometers depending on the event. This intense cardiovascular effort raises the heart rate and causes heavy breathing, making the subsequent shooting stages all the more challenging.

The shooting component requires a completely different set of skills. Biathletes must quickly transition from the dynamic skiing state to a position of absolute stillness. They typically shoot from two positions: prone (lying down) and standing. In each position, they must hit five targets at a distance of 50 meters. The targets are small – just 45mm in diameter for prone shooting and 115mm for standing.

What makes this particularly challenging is the physiological state of the athletes when they arrive at the shooting range. With elevated heart rates and heavy breathing from the skiing portion, they must rapidly calm themselves to achieve the steadiness required for accurate shooting. This demands exceptional body awareness and control.

The rifle itself presents another layer of complexity. Biathlon rifles are specialized equipment, typically weighing between 3.5 to 4.5 kilograms. They must be carried throughout the entire race, adding to the physical burden of the skiing portion. The rifles are designed for quick and easy handling, with special features like improved sights and refined triggers to aid in rapid, accurate shooting.

Weather conditions add yet another variable to the mix. Wind, temperature, and visibility can all affect both the skiing and shooting portions of the event. Athletes must be adept at reading these conditions and adjusting their performance accordingly, whether it’s altering their ski technique or compensating for wind drift in their shooting.

Training for Biathlon: A Holistic Approach

Preparing for biathlon competition requires a multifaceted training regimen that addresses both the physical and mental aspects of the sport. Athletes must develop exceptional cardiovascular fitness, strength, and skiing technique while simultaneously honing their marksmanship skills and mental fortitude.

The endurance component of biathlon training closely resembles that of cross-country skiers. Athletes engage in long, slow-distance training to build their aerobic base, often incorporating activities like running, cycling, and roller skiing in the off-season. High-intensity interval training is crucial for developing the ability to maintain high speeds on the course and recover quickly for the shooting stages.

Strength training plays a vital role in biathlon performance. Athletes need strong legs and core muscles for powerful skiing, as well as upper body strength for rifle control. Specialized exercises that mimic the movements of skiing and shooting are often incorporated into training routines.

Shooting practice is, of course, a fundamental part of biathlon training. Athletes spend countless hours at the range, perfecting their technique in both prone and standing positions. Dry-firing (practicing without ammunition) is a common method for developing muscle memory and refining trigger control. Many biathletes also use laser training systems that allow them to practice their shooting technique indoors or during the off-season.

Perhaps one of the most unique aspects of biathlon training is the focus on the transition between skiing and shooting. Athletes practice skiing at race pace and then quickly settling into their shooting position, aiming to minimize the time and energy lost in this crucial phase. This often involves simulated race conditions where athletes ski loops before coming into a mock shooting range.

Mental training is equally important in biathlon. Athletes must develop strategies to manage stress, maintain focus, and make split-second decisions under pressure. Techniques such as visualization, mindfulness, and breathing exercises are commonly employed to enhance mental performance.

The Psychology of Biathlon: Mastering the Mental Game

The psychological demands of biathlon set it apart from many other sports. The constant switching between high-intensity skiing and precision shooting requires exceptional mental agility and emotional control. Athletes must be able to shift their focus rapidly, transitioning from the aggressive, full-body engagement of skiing to the calm, centered state needed for accurate shooting.

One of the key psychological challenges in biathlon is managing arousal levels. During the skiing portions, athletes benefit from a high state of arousal – increased heart rate, heightened awareness, and a surge of adrenaline. However, this same state can be detrimental to shooting performance, where calmness and steadiness are crucial. Successful biathletes develop the ability to quickly down-regulate their arousal levels as they approach the shooting range.

Another critical psychological skill in biathlon is the management of pressure. Missing a target incurs a time penalty or requires skiing an extra loop, which can dramatically affect an athlete’s standing in the race. This creates intense pressure during each shooting stage, particularly in close competitions. Athletes must learn to embrace this pressure and maintain their focus despite the high stakes.

The ability to adapt to changing conditions is also a crucial mental skill in biathlon. Weather conditions can shift rapidly during a race, affecting both skiing and shooting. Athletes must be able to adjust their strategy on the fly, making quick decisions about pacing, shooting technique, and tactical approaches.

Resilience is another key psychological trait for biathletes. Given the complexity of the sport, even the best athletes will have races where things don’t go as planned. The ability to bounce back from disappointments, learn from mistakes, and maintain confidence is essential for long-term success in the sport.

Many top biathletes work with sports psychologists to develop these mental skills. Techniques such as positive self-talk, pre-performance routines, and mindfulness practices are commonly used to enhance psychological performance. Some athletes also use biofeedback training to gain better control over their physiological responses, particularly in managing the transition from skiing to shooting.

The Global Landscape of Biathlon

While biathlon has its roots in Scandinavia and Central Europe, it has grown into a truly global sport. The International Biathlon Union (IBU), founded in 1993, now counts over 60 national federations as members. The sport enjoys particular popularity in countries with strong winter sports traditions, including Norway, Germany, France, Russia, and Sweden.

The World Cup circuit, which runs from late November to late March, is the pinnacle of the biathlon season outside of the Olympics and World Championships. It features a series of events across Europe and occasionally North America, with athletes competing for overall and discipline-specific titles. The variety of events – including individual races, sprints, pursuits, mass starts, and relays – provides a comprehensive test of biathlon skills and adds excitement for spectators.

In recent years, efforts have been made to expand the global reach of biathlon. The IBU has implemented development programs to support emerging biathlon nations, providing coaching, equipment, and competition opportunities. This has led to the rise of competitive biathletes from countries not traditionally associated with the sport, such as China, Japan, and the United States.

The Olympic Games remain the most prestigious stage for biathlon. Since its full inclusion in 1960, the number of biathlon events has expanded from one to eleven, reflecting the sport’s growing popularity and diversity. The mixed relay, introduced in 2014, has been a particularly exciting addition, showcasing both male and female athletes on the same team.

Television coverage has played a crucial role in biathlon’s growth. The sport’s combination of endurance racing and marksmanship provides natural drama that translates well to broadcast. Innovations in camera technology, including drone footage and rifle-mounted cameras, have enhanced the viewing experience, allowing spectators to feel closer to the action.

Technological Advancements in Biathlon

Like many sports, biathlon has been significantly impacted by technological advancements. These innovations have not only improved performance but also enhanced the fairness of competition and the spectator experience.

In terms of equipment, ski technology has seen substantial developments. Modern biathlon skis are lighter and more responsive than their predecessors, allowing for greater speed and maneuverability. Boots and bindings have also evolved, providing better power transfer and control. Ski suits are now designed with advanced materials that offer optimal thermoregulation and aerodynamics.

Rifle technology has also progressed considerably. Modern biathlon rifles are precision instruments, with features like improved sights, adjustable stocks, and refined triggers. Some rifles now incorporate carbon fiber components to reduce weight without sacrificing stability. Ammunition has been refined to provide consistent performance across a range of temperatures and conditions.

Perhaps the most significant technological advancement in biathlon has been the introduction of electronic targets. These targets, first used in World Cup events in the 1980s, provide instant feedback on shot accuracy. They use acoustic sensors to detect the impact of the bullet, displaying the result immediately on a screen visible to both the athlete and spectators. This has eliminated scoring disputes and dramatically improved the viewing experience.

Wearable technology has also found its place in biathlon training. Athletes now use heart rate monitors, GPS devices, and even power meters to track their performance and optimize their training. Some teams have experimented with augmented reality systems for shooting practice, allowing athletes to simulate race conditions more effectively.

Climate change has posed challenges for winter sports, including biathlon. In response, venues have invested in snowmaking technology and snow preservation techniques. Some facilities now use underground cooling systems to maintain snow conditions, ensuring consistent and fair competitions even in warmer temperatures.

The Future of Biathlon: Challenges and Opportunities

As biathlon moves into the future, it faces both challenges and opportunities. One of the primary concerns is the impact of climate change on winter sports. Rising global temperatures are shortening winter seasons and reducing natural snowfall in many traditional biathlon venues. This has led to increased reliance on artificial snow and the need to develop more sustainable practices in the sport.

Adapting to these environmental changes may involve adjusting the competitive calendar, developing new race formats that require less snow, or investing in more sustainable venue technologies. Some have even suggested the possibility of indoor biathlon facilities, though this would significantly alter the nature of the sport.

Another challenge for biathlon is maintaining and expanding its global appeal. While the sport has a strong following in Europe, it faces stiffer competition for attention and resources in other parts of the world. Efforts to grow the sport in North America and Asia are ongoing, with a focus on youth development programs and increased media exposure.

The issue of doping remains a concern in biathlon, as it does in many endurance sports. The IBU has implemented strict anti-doping measures, including the Athlete Biological Passport program, but vigilance is required to maintain the integrity of the sport.

On the opportunity side, biathlon’s unique combination of endurance and precision offers potential for crossover appeal to fans of other sports. The dramatic nature of the competition, with its sudden shifts between skiing and shooting, provides natural storytelling opportunities that could be leveraged for broader media coverage.

Technological innovations continue to offer possibilities for enhancing both athlete performance and spectator experience. Virtual and augmented reality technologies could provide new ways for fans to engage with the sport, while advances in training technology may help athletes push the boundaries of human performance even further.

There’s also potential for biathlon to expand its event portfolio. Summer biathlon events, which replace skiing with running or roller skiing, have gained some traction and could provide opportunities for year-round engagement with the sport. New race formats or team events could also be developed to add variety and excitement to competitions.
